    How do I format numbers for French-style in Excel v.X for mac?

    I need to make the English supplied numbering style French formatted.

    eg.

    English: 2,344.5%

    to French: 2 344,5 %

    Does anyone on a mac (OSX) know how to do this with Excel v.X?

    Re: How do I format numbers for French-style in Excel v.X for mac?

    Mac XL v.X (and 98/01/04) takes its default number formats from the
    System - change the format in the International pane of the System
    Preferences.
